In a recent development, the tender for the redesign of Palatine Square has been withdrawn due to a lack of economically viable bids. The city administration, however, remains optimistic about the future of the project and plans to launch a new tender after revising the documents.

The aim of the new redesign is to improve traffic safety and enhance the square, taking into consideration the existing tree stock. The square, located within the North City II redevelopment area, is intended to make the entire district more attractive.

Originally laid out in 1913 and redesigned in the 1970s, Palatine Square has been planned for a second attempt at redevelopment. The construction costs submitted for the previous tender were deemed unacceptable by the city administration, with the costs being significantly higher than the existing cost estimate.

Building Director Sibylle Schüssler expressed optimism about the project, stating that the city administration will revise the tender documents to make the bid submission more attractive and increase the chances of receiving economic bids.

The new tender is expected to be launched after the document revisions, with the award for the redesign of Palatine Square expected to take place after the summer holidays. The construction work will be delayed by about half a year due to the delay in the award process, but the city administration is working diligently to ensure a smooth and efficient process.
